L Vol (HeadPhone) Register4-104.6.2 L Vol (Line Input) RegisterAddress: 0000000D4–D0 set the left line input volume. D8 sets simultaneous right/leftv
Audio (Digital) Register4-11SoftwareD7–D6 set the sidetone attenuation (00 = –6 dB, 01 = –9 dB, 10 = –12 dB, 11 = –15 dB). D5 sets sidetone enable (0
